🌡️ Weather Overview: Cancun in Every Season

Cancun stays tropical and sunny almost year-round with temps between 75–90°F (24–32°C). Here’s what to expect:

  • Winter (Dec–Feb): Warm, breezy days and slightly cooler nights—perfect for beach lounging and rooftop dinners.
  • Spring (Mar–May): Hot and sunny, with rising humidity.
  • Summer (Jun–Aug): Very hot and humid with higher rain chances—pack waterproofs and breezy clothes.
  • Fall (Sep–Nov): Warm with occasional showers—shoulder season perks + fewer crowds.

🎒 What to Pack for Cancun: Fashion & Beach Etiquette

Cancun is all about resort chic + beach glam by day, and sultry elegance by night. Think breezy linens, swimwear, cover-ups, and flowy dresses. Modesty isn’t required at beaches, but consider lightweight cover-ups when entering shops or restaurants.

✈️ Travel Tips

  • Confirm check-in/check-out times
  • Pack reef-safe sunscreen
  • Don’t drink tap water—bottled only
  • Tip in pesos: 10–15% is standard
  • Exchange a small amount of currency before arrival

🛂 Visa Tips

  • U.S., Canada, EU: No visa required
  • Bring printed hotel & return flight info
  • FMM tourist card is given upon entry—don’t lose it!
